Beschreibung:

The Dramatick Works of John Dryden, 6 volumes, Jacob Tonson, 1735, titles printed in red and black, several engraved plates, contemporary uniform full calf, gilt decorated spines, rubbed and some wear to joints and extreme corners, 12mo, together with Rowe (Elizabeth) , The Miscellaneous Works in Prose and Verse, of Mrs Elizabeth Rowe, 2 volumes, 3rd edition, corrected, to which is now first added, The History of Joseph, A Poem, 1750, old ownership signature to head of title of each volume excised, engraved bookplate of Thomas Munro to front pastedown of each, early 19th century dark blue gilt-decorated full morocco, very slightly rubbed, 12mo, plus other 18th century and early 19th century English literature, poetry, etc., including Petis de la Croix, The Turkish Tales, 2 volumes, 6th edition, Dublin, 1770, Letters from a Persian in England to his Friend at Ispahan, 3rd edition, 1735, Clarissa by Samuel Richardson, 8 volumes, new edition, 1785, Tales of My Landlord, Fourth and Last Series, by Walter Scott 4 volumes, 1832, etc., all leather bound, 8vo/12mo (63)
